Painting Description
"The Glazier's Costume" is a notable work by the Family of Engravers Bonnart, a distinguished group of French artists active during the late 17th and early 18th centuries. The Bonnart family, comprising brothers Nicolas, Robert, Henri, and Jean-Baptiste, were renowned for their detailed and elegant engravings, which often depicted contemporary fashion, social scenes, and trades. Their works are considered significant for their contribution to the documentation of the period's cultural and sartorial history.
"The Glazier's Costume" is part of a larger series of engravings that illustrate various professions and their associated attire. This particular engraving provides a detailed depiction of a glazier, a craftsman specialized in cutting, installing, and removing glass. The artwork captures the essence of the trade through meticulous attention to the glazier's tools, attire, and the context in which he operates. The depiction is not only an artistic representation but also serves as a historical record of the occupational dress and tools used during that era.
The Bonnart family's engravings are characterized by their precision and clarity, often accompanied by descriptive texts that provide further insight into the subject matter. "The Glazier's Costume" is no exception, offering viewers a glimpse into the daily life and work of a glazier. The engraving reflects the Bonnart family's skill in combining artistic beauty with documentary accuracy, making their works valuable to both art historians and those interested in the history of trades and professions.
The Bonnart engravings, including "The Glazier's Costume," were widely distributed and collected, influencing fashion and providing a visual reference for costume designers, artists, and historians. Today, these works are preserved in various museums and collections, continuing to be appreciated for their artistic merit and historical significance.
